We extend our heartfelt gratitude to everyone who helped make Cuyahoga Falls Neighborhood Reborn on Friday, June 27, and Saturday, June 28, such an outstanding success! Thanks to the incredible dedication of our volunteers, staff, and the generous support of our community partners, we were able to complete 12 meaningful home repair projects for residents living near Lincoln Elementary School in Cuyahoga Falls.
Together, we improved the safety, comfort, and curb appeal of these homes, while also strengthening the sense of pride and connection within the neighborhood.
